<p>The <a href="http://rmvr.com/event/2012-drivers-school/">2012 Drivers&#8217; School</a> will not be your typical RMVR School! And not just for new drivers!</p>
<p>It has been confirmed that RMVR will have a big name professional driver as a guest instructor our 2012 Drivers School. Through the efforts of Bob Raub and <a href="http://www.3rauto.com/">3R Racing</a>, <a href="http://www.randypobst.com/">Randy Pobst</a> will help out with instructing at the School. Randy is a 2 time SCCA National Champion, a 4 time World Challenge series Champion, and 2 time winner at the 24 Hours of Daytona.</p>
<p><img alt="" src="http://rmvr.com/assets/images/randy-probst.jpg" title="Randy Probst" class="alignright" width="266" height="178" />Randy will be at the classroom session on Friday evening, at the track all day on Saturday, and until noon on Sunday. If you have ever thought about attending the Precision or Competition Schools, this is definitely the time to do it. Whether you have been racing for 2 years or 15 years, RMVR members are encouraged to consider signing up for this event (space for veterans will be limited to ensure plenty of room for the students.) Here’s what Lynn Fangue, Chief Driving Instructor, has to say, &#8220;We are very excited to have someone of the caliber of Randy Pobst associated with our school. He is excited about the opportunity to offer our students his expertise and to drive some of our vintage cars at the lunch rides both days. This is shaping up to be our best school ever. There will be some other firsts at this event as well.&#8221; Veteran drivers, you will be able to sit in on all of the classroom sessions and have a special session exclusively with Randy, or go through the full school again with all of the track time students get. Pricing for the veterans will be determined shortly. </p>
<p>One of the other &#8220;firsts&#8221; Lynn is referring to is track time. The plan is to have over three hours of track time for both the Precision and Competition students. Having separate groups this year will maximize your track sessions, and allow the curriculum for the Precision students to be modified to better target their needs. </p>
<p>Another first is the opportunity to participate in a Skid Pad session on Friday afternoon. This will be open to both student and veteran drivers. If you have never done this or it has been awhile, it is a great chance to see how your car does in &#8220;steady state cornering.&#8221; You can clearly identify over steer or under steer conditions and get some ideas as to how to correct them.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>RMVR has a plethora of choices in cars and classes to go vintage racing. There is something for everyone! But that variety means lots of choices and lots of decisions and, as a by-product, lots of rules. The following guide will aid you in the process of submitting your car for eligibility.</p>
<p>To prepare a car for RMVR eligibility, you should first be sure to read the appropriate RMVR rules for preparation of your car. No sense in making modifications to the car only to find out the modifications aren&#8217;t legal.</p>
<p>In most cases, RMVR&#8217;s rules for preparing cars are based on previous versions of SCCA&#8217;s General Competition Rules (GCR) including the appropriate SCCA Production Car Specifications (PCS) or GT Car Specifications (GTCS) for that era. Cars must also conform to RMVR Exceptions to those rules. Those exceptions exist for a variety of reasons (updated safety, allowing some other modifications, or clarifying some SCCA ambiguity). Be sure to read and understand all these documents related to your race car.</p>
<p>In addition to the rules, the Application For Eligibility form is specific to your particular class of car. To help you find the correct rules and application, please refer to the table below. We have Specialists on the Eligibility Team to help you. The names, phone numbers and email addresses of those Specialists are provided in the respective Applications. Please work with the Specialist on any questions you might have prior to submitting the competed form.</p>
<p>The Eligibility Specialist will then review your application and advise you in writing of its acceptance or (hopefully not) rejection. If your application is accepted, you&#8217;ll receive a fresh RMVR Logbook and the assigned number for the car. If it is rejected, the letter will explain the deficiency. The Specialist will be available to work with you to resolve any issues.</p>
<p>If you have purchased a car which previously had an RMVR logbook, you will need to submit the car for eligibility again. Having a prior logbook with a prior owner does not insure that the car still meets eligibility requirements. The club&#8217;s familiarity with the car will help expedite the process. The previous car number assigned by RMVR does not go with a car when sold. You can apply for that same number, but the club reserves the right to assign a new number. We&#8217;ll try, but can&#8217;t guarantee the same number is still available.</p>
